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70 89285639691 8908098874 29850083248
707 58102763 5860
707 58102763 5860
465256 227246301 38255 08 331
All about undefined
Interested in learning more?
707 58102763 5860
465256 227246301 38255 08 331
See more
4854943440 951531
88835771560 33 9378
See more
52 96037762 51341
51600288 823669431 845653264
See more